Borussia Dortmund signs Bayern's Sebastian Rode

DORTMUND, Germany (AP) — Borussia Dortmund says it has signed defensive midfielder Sebastian Rode from Bundesliga rival Bayern Munich.

Rode signed a four-year contract. No financial details were given.

Rode played for Eintracht Frankfurt before moving to Bayern in 2014

He is the fourth player to sign for Dortmund since the end of the season, in which Dortmund finished second to Bayern.

Defender Marc Bartra became a Dortmund player over the weekend, and young talents Ousmane Dembele and Mikel Merino were brought in.

However, defender Mats Hummels left for Bayern, and midfielder Ilkay Gundogan is moving to Manchester City.
